KUTENO Kunststofftechnik Nord: A Focused Platform for the Future of Plastics Processing
Since its launch in 2018, KUTENO Kunststofftechnik Nord has rapidly grown into a central meeting point for the plastics processing industry in Northern Germany and beyond. As an annual trade fair, it was created in response to the industry’s need for a compact, high-quality, and practice-oriented event where professionals can exchange ideas, discover innovations, and build meaningful business relationships. Despite its relatively young history, KUTENO has established a strong reputation by consistently delivering relevance, efficiency, and professional depth.
The event is organized by Easyfairs GmbH, a globally active trade fair organizer with many years of experience across various industries. This background has played a crucial role in shaping KUTENO into a modern, well-structured trade show that prioritizes substance over scale and quality over quantity.

ICE Europe: Europe’s Leading Trade Fair for Web-Based Materials and Converting Technologies
In the world of web-based material processing, innovation never stands still. ICE Europe, held every two years in March at the world-class Messe München exhibition center in Germany, has emerged as the most significant trade fair dedicated to the finishing and converting of materials like paper, film, foil, and nonwovens. Since its establishment in 1999, the show has grown into an indispensable meeting place for professionals from across industries that rely on advanced converting processes.
ICE Europe offers a truly international platform where engineers, developers, suppliers, buyers, and consultants come together to explore the latest technologies, discuss market developments, and build long-lasting business relationships. The event is organized by Mack-Brooks Exhibitions Ltd, part of Reed Exhibitions, underscoring its international reputation and professional scale.
Converting Technologies at the Forefront of Industrial Progress
The converting industry plays a crucial role in modern manufacturing and packaging. It enables the transformation of raw, flat, or rolled materials into finished or semi-finished products ready for use in various applications. ICE Europe reflects this importance by covering the entire converting value chain, from pre-treatment to final packaging.

Foam Expo Europe: Connecting the Future of the Foam Industry
As Europe’s largest exhibition and conference dedicated to the foam industry, Foam Expo Europe serves as a vital meeting point for professionals, innovators, and organizations from across the entire technical foam supply chain. Held annually, the event offers free access to all attendees, making it not only the most comprehensive but also the most accessible forum for knowledge exchange and industry development in the sector.
From raw materials and processing equipment to finished products and future applications, Foam Expo Europe brings together the entire foam ecosystem.
